This perky little girl came to us, with a litter of puppies, by way of Lee County Domestic Animal Services. We pull dogs and cats from LCDAS somewhat regularly, as sadly, they can’t help but run out of room often. Sarah came to us testing positive for Heartworm disease. As always, we fully treated her, and she is now available for adoption.

Sarah definitely takes some time to get to know most people, particularly men. She is very sweet once she gets used to you, but will definitely require multiple visits on the part of a potential adopter. Why not come out and meet this little girl?

My ideal home:
I need a young, quieter home to call my own.
I'm good with:
Men Women
I'm not good with:
Most Other Dogs Young Children
